Report: Steering Dampening Shock Will Leak Fluid When it Fails
Mercedes-Benz S350 Problem
Model Years Affected: 1994, 1995
Verified
A fluid leak from the front of the vehicle may be a result of a worn steering dampening shock. Our technicians tell us that if a leak is noted from the dampening shock it should be replaced.
